Earlier this morning, Mi7 Control Room Operators received information from a community group, in which a Wartburg resident put out a distress call asking for assistance. The resident reported a housebreaking was in progress at their home.
Mi7 teams, working alongside their peers from other security service providers, were immediately dispatched. It was established that four suspects had entered the premises and stole various electronic items, fleeing as security teams arrived.
A foot chase ensued, and Mi7 teams apprehended one suspect. He was found in possession of two stolen laptops. Two others were apprehended by other security service providers. One got away.
The suspects had also stabbed the family dog. The dog was taken to the vet for medical attention, and luckily, no residents were injured.
The matter was handed over to the police for further investigation.
